Hi,
I unfortunately just noticed this now, just after we released...
In
commit 9e98583898c347e007958c8a09911be2ea4acfb9
Author: Michael Paquier <michael@paquier.xyz>
Date: 2022-03-07 10:26:29 +0900
Create routine able to set single-call SRFs for Materialize mode
a new helper was added:
#define SRF_SINGLE_USE_EXPECTED 0x01 /* use expectedDesc as tupdesc */
#define SRF_SINGLE_BLESS 0x02 /* validate tuple for SRF */
extern void SetSingleFuncCall(FunctionCallInfo fcinfo, bits32 flags);
I think the naming here is very poor. For one, "Single" here conflicts with
ExprSingleResult which indicates "expression does not return a set",
i.e. precisely the opposite what SetSingleFuncCall() is used for. For another
the "Set" in SetSingleFuncCall makes it sound like it's function setting a
property.
Even leaving the confusion with ExprSingleResult aside, calling it "Single"
still seems very non-descriptive. I assume it's named to contrast with
init_MultiFuncCall() etc. While those are also not named greatly, they're not
typically used directly but wraped in SRF_FIRSTCALL_INIT etc.
I also quite intensely dislike SRF_SINGLE_USE_EXPECTED. It sounds like it's
saying that a single use of the SRF is expected, but that's not at all what it
means: "use expectedDesc as tupdesc".
I'm also confused by SRF_SINGLE_BLESS - the comment says "validate tuple for
SRF". BlessTupleDesc can't really be described as validation, or am I missing
something?
This IMO needs to be cleaned up.
Maybe something like InitMaterializedSRF() w/
MAT_SRF_(USE_EXPECTED_DESC|BLESS)
